Multi - Agency Task Effort Leads to ArrestALBUQUERQUE , NM—On May 2 , 2022 , the United States Marshals Service Southwest Investigative Fugitive Task Force ( SWIFT ) arrested Jonathan Gabriel Martinez in the northeast area of Albuquerque . A felony arrest warrant had been issued in Bernalillo County in October of last year . Martinez had been charged in the July 10 , 2021 , murder of Trevonte Robbins . During the incident , Robbins was struck and killed by gunfire and another victim sustained gunshot injuries . This incident occurred in the vicinity of Central Avenue and 4th Street in Albuquerque . The warrant , filed in the Second Judicial Circuit , charges Jonathan Gabriel Martinez with first - degree murder , conspiracy , aggravated battery with a deadly weapon , aggravated assault with a deadly weapon , and assault with intent to commit a violent felony ( murder ) . The U . S . Marshals Service was asked to join the investigation in search of Martinez in November 2022 . Upon his arrest today , investigators found a silver revolver on the floorboard of the vehicle Martinez had been driving and a woolen “ski mask , ” with apertures for the eyes and mouth . “Today’s arrest of Martinez is significant because it sends a message to all violent offenders that they will not be allowed to continue to instill fear in our community , ” said Sonya K . Chavez , United States Marshal for the District of New Mexico . “Our community deserves peace of mind and so do the families of the victims of these heinous crimes , ” she added . “This investigation highlights the strong partnership the Albuquerque Police Department shares with our many law enforcement partners , ” said Harold Medina , chief of the Albuquerque Police Department . “Martinez’ arrest is an example of how working together can bring significant cases like this to an end and give some closure to the victims’ families , ” he added . The United States Marshals Service District of New Mexico Southwest Investigative Fugitive Task Force is comprised of investigators from various state , local , and federal law enforcement agencies . Those involved in the apprehension of Martinez include , the Albuquerque Police Department , Bernalillo County Sheriff ' s Office , New Mexico State Police , New Mexico Department of Corrections - Probation & Parole , Department of Homeland Security , and the United States Marshals Service .
